The U.S. Copyright Office Discourages Monkey Business

$
0
0
Practice Area(s): 
Copyright

On August 19, 2014, the Register of Copyrights, Maria A. Pallante, released a public draft of the Compendium of U.S. Copyright Office Practices, Third Edition (the “Compendium Third Edition”).

In the draft, the U.S. Copyright Office makes it clear that a photograph taken by a monkey is not considered registrable because it was not created by a human being.   Thus, the monkey “selfie” that has attracted so much media attention in recent weeks cannot be registered.
